  3. recovery wasn't too bad. i went back to work 6 days post op. i have a desk job and didn't have a lot of problems. i have an amazing amount of energy now the hardest part is getting in my protein and water - but it can be done!

I was always a chunky kid. When you're a baby, everyone thinks it's cute. Even into elementary school, it's acceptable to be a plump kid (at least it was in the 80's when I was in school). Around 5th grade it started to cause problems at school, especially as I started getting boobs, not just fat rolls.
